Summary

This summary covers six available inspections for CANNING, MARGARITA FAMILY CHILD CARE from August 5, 2021 through September 24, 2024.

Two inspections recorded violations, with 10 recorded violations in total.

The most recent higher-concern violation was on February 7, 2023 and involved environmental health, with a due date of February 8, 2023.

Three later inspections, from February 21, 2023 through September 24, 2024, showed no recorded violations, but the records do not say whether they were formal follow-ups.

Higher concern: Environmental health
Report finding
Operation of A Family Child Care Home (g) The home shall be free from defects or conditions which might endanger a child. Safety precautions shall include but not limited to: (5) All licensees shall ensure the inaccessibility of pools (in-ground and above-ground), fixed-in-place wading pools, hot tubs, spas, fish ponds and similar bodies of water through a pool cover or by surrounding the pool with a fence. This requirement is not met as evidenced by: Based on observation the licensee did not comply with the section cited above as there was a square container with approximately one foot by one foot wide and one foot deep that was full of water in accessible back yard which poses an immediate health, safety or personal rights risk to persons in care.
Correction status
Plan of correction due by February 8, 2023

Higher concern: Staff-to-child ratio
Report finding
Staffing Ratio and Capacity-102416.5(d)(1): For a Large Family Child Care Home, the maximum number of children for whom care may be provided at any one time when there is an assistant provider in the home...shall be either: Twelve children, no more than four of whom may be infants; or...This requirement was not met as evidenced by: Based on observation Licensee was caring for 5 infants at one time for a total capacity of 11 children.This poses an immediate health and safety risk to children in care.
Correction status
Plan of correction due by August 6, 2021
